
Volrab DSR Capsule
Marketer
Biochemix Health Care Pvt. Ltd.
Salt Composition
Domperidone (30mg) + Rabeprazole (20mg)
Overview Volrab DSR Capsule
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D, or acid reflux) can be effectively managed with Volrab DSR Capsules, a dual-action formulation. This medication alleviates symptoms like heartburn, abdominal pain, and irritation by neutralizing stomach acid and facilitating gas expulsion, thereby easing discomfort. As directed by your physician, take Volrab DSR Capsules on an empty stomach, adhering to the prescribed dosage and duration. Treatment length depends on your individual response and condition. Prem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and disease exacerbation. Always inform your doctor of all other medications you are using, as interactions are possible. Common, typically transient side effects include diarrhea, abdominal pain, dry mouth, headache, flatulence, and fatigue.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are potential side effects; avoid driving or tasks requiring alertness until the medication's effects are known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ential increased drowsiness. Lifestyle changes, such as consuming cool milk and limiting hot beverages, spicy foods, and chocolate, can enhance treatment outcomes.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ney or liver conditions, p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ding to your doctor.

How Volrab DSR Capsule works:
Volrab DSR Capsules contain Domperidone and Rabeprazole, two medications working synergistically. Domperidone, a prokinetic agent, enhances gastrointestinal motility, facilitating smoother food passage through the stomach. Rabeprazole, a proton pump inhibitor (PPI), lowers stomach acid production, providing relief from acid indigestion and heartburn symptoms.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Exercise caution when using Volrab DSR Capsule alongside alcohol.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Volrab DSR Capsules during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Physician consultation is advised.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Volrab DSR Capsules while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ving should be avoided if using Volrab DSR Capsules, as they can cause drowsiness, visual disturbances, dizziness, and reduced attentiveness.
KidneyCAUTION
Exercise caution when prescribing Volrab DSR Capsules to individuals with impaired renal function. Dosage modification for Volrab DSR Capsules may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Volrab DSR Cap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Volrab DSR Capsules are contraindicated for individuals with moderate to severe hepatic dysfunction.
